航空摄影测量是一门理论性和实践性都很强的课程,实验教学在其中起着关键的作用。本文首先对该课程实验教学中存在的问题以及教学改革的必要性进行了分析,然后结合无人机航空摄影测量实习的特点,采用虚拟现实技术,建立了无人机航空摄影测量实验教学平台。对于解决实践环节中成本高、风险大、时间长、效果差等问题极具理论和现实意义,可为遥感科学与技术专业的实践教学改革提供有益的参考和借鉴。
Photogrammetry is a very theoretical and practical course, and experimental teaching plays a key role in it. This paper first analyzes the problems in the experiment teaching and the necessity of the teaching reform, and then combines the characteristics of the photogrammetry practice and advantages of VR technology to set up an experimental teaching platform for the UAV-based photogrammetry. It is of great theoretical and practical significance to solve the problems of high cost, high risk, long time and poor effect in the practice, which can provide useful reference for the reform of the practical teaching of Remote Sensing Science and technology.
